Sojeong Cactus
Parodia scopa
Parodia scopa is a cactus native to South America that has a spherical or slightly cylindrical shape. This cactus is primarily characterized by its silver spines, and in the summer, it blooms with yellow or orange flowers, adding to its visual appeal. The following covers the growth characteristics, propagation methods, cultivation techniques, garden uses, and major pests and diseases, as well as control methods for Parodia scopa. - Growth Characteristics: - It requires plenty of sunlight and grows in locations with good direct sunlight. - It prefers well-draining soil and is sensitive to overwatering. - It thrives in dry environments and can tolerate low temperatures to some extent. - Propagation Methods: - It is primarily propagated by seeds, which are sown in spring or early summer. - When sowing, use well-draining soil and plant the seeds shallowly. - Germination may take from a few days to several weeks; care should be taken to avoid overwatering during this period. 3. Cultivation Method: - Water only after the soil has completely dried out, and reduce watering during the winter. - Regularly apply fertilizer specifically designed for cacti during the growing season from spring to autumn. - If using a pot, mix in coarse sand or gravel to improve drainage. - Use in the Garden: - Primarily used in rock gardens or gardening in dry conditions. - Suitable for ornamental purposes due to its small size and diverse flower colors. - Creates a significant visual effect when placed alongside other succulents or cacti. - Important Pests and Control Methods: - Root rot can occur due to overwatering, so attention must be paid to drainage. - Pests such as blue mold or scale insects may occur; if pests appear, use insecticides or control them with natural predators. - Regularly observing the plant is crucial for early detection and management of pests and diseases. While Parodia scopa is relatively easy to care for, understanding its characteristics and providing proper care will allow for healthier growth.
